### Bulk edits failing in the Pondwick admin table

If a customer reports that bulk edits silently fail (rows look updated but revert on refresh), it's usually an expired auth session on the Grendale admin API. The UI doesn't surface the 401 — known bug, fix is queued. Workaround: have them retry after re-login, or reproduce it yourself in staging using the support token below.

session JWT of yawep-yawep = eyJhbGciOiJIUzI1NiIsInR5cCI6IkpXVCJ9.eyJzdWIiOiI3pWF3_In0.aXYsHiog

Subject: Key rotation — Harborline SFTP drop

On-call: the credential for the Harborline partner SFTP drop rotates at 02:00 UTC tonight. Partner uploads pause for roughly five minutes during cutover.

If the poller alarms after 02:10, restart the ingest worker first — it caches the old key. Don't re-enable the previous credential; it's revoked at rotation time.

The watcher service that verifies inbound manifests also needs the new value in its env config.

New key for the ingest service is below.

API key for yahig-tadup: kto7_ubizbYm

**CI note — kiosk watchdog flaking**

Pavilion kiosk app: watchdog restarts the shell mid-test because the CI runner throttles CPU, so heartbeat misses its 5s window. Not a product bug. Fix: bump heartbeat tolerance to 12s in CI config only; prod unchanged. Verified locally and on runner pool B. Don't merge the tolerance into the device profile. Repro disappears with the patched watchdog config. The passing build's trace token follows.

session token of yajof-bagef = htk4_937d